Stunning Fossil Discovery Challenges Animal Life Origins

Ancient Microfossils Redraw Our Picture of Early Life on Earth The discovery of fossilized bacteria and algae in Brazil has sent shockwaves through the scientific community by challenging long held assumptions about the origins of animal life on our planet.

A team of researchers reexamining 540 million year old microfossils from Mato Grosso do Sul found that what were once thought to be trails left behind by tiny worm like creatures are actually evidence of ancient microbial communities.

This finding has significant implications for our understanding of the Ediacaran period, a time when oxygen levels in oceans were still relatively low.
